How can I optimize the performance of a Rinnai RUS Model Series tankless water heater, like the RUS65eP, for my household's needs?
Optimizing the performance of a Rinnai RUS Model Series tankless water heater, such as the RUS65eP, is essential to ensure that it meets your household's hot water needs efficiently. Here are several steps you can take to maximize its performance:
Proper Sizing:
Ensure that the RUS65eP is appropriately sized for your household's hot water demands. Tankless water heaters are sized based on the number of fixtures and the flow rate required. Consult the manufacturer's guidelines or seek professional advice to confirm that the unit matches your needs.
Temperature Settings:
Set the water temperature to a comfortable and safe level. The recommended temperature for most households is around 120°F (49°C). This temperature provides sufficient hot water for various tasks while minimizing the risk of scalding.
Flow Rate and Capacity:
Understand the flow rate and capacity of your RUS65eP. This information is essential to determine the number of fixtures and appliances that can be supplied with hot water simultaneously. Ensure that your household's hot water demands do not exceed the unit's capacity.
Hot Water Priority:
Configure the water heater to prioritize hot water delivery to critical fixtures, such as showers and sinks, over less essential appliances like dishwashers or washing machines. This ensures that you consistently have hot water where it matters most.
Coldwater Bypass Valve:
Consider installing a coldwater bypass valve. This device allows you to adjust the ratio of hot to cold water, which can help fine-tune the water temperature and improve comfort.
Regular Maintenance:
Schedule routine maintenance for your RUS65eP. This includes flushing the unit to remove scale and debris, checking for leaks or loose connections, and inspecting the venting system.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for maintenance intervals.
Water Quality:
Pay attention to water quality in your area. Hard water can lead to scale buildup inside the unit, reducing efficiency. Consider installing a water softener or descaling the unit periodically to mitigate scale-related issues.
Insulation:
Insulate the hot water pipes leading from the tankless water heater to your fixtures. Insulated pipes help maintain hot water temperature and reduce heat loss, ensuring that you receive hot water quickly and efficiently.
Cold Weather Considerations:
If you live in a region with cold winters, take measures to prevent freezing. Ensure the unit is properly insulated and consider adding heat tracing cable to the water lines to prevent freezing.
Hot Water Recirculation System:
If you want instant hot water at your faucets and fixtures, consider installing a hot water recirculation system. This system circulates hot water through the pipes, reducing the time it takes for hot water to reach your taps and minimizing water wastage.
Low-Flow Fixtures:
Install low-flow faucets and showerheads to reduce hot water consumption. These fixtures can significantly decrease the amount of water you use, which can extend the duration of hot water availability.
Energy Efficiency:
To optimize energy efficiency, consider installing a condensing model if available. Condensing tankless water heaters capture and use heat from exhaust gases, increasing overall efficiency.
Timer or Scheduling:
Some tankless water heaters have timer or scheduling features. Use these to program when the unit operates, adjusting it to match your household's hot water needs throughout the day. This can help save energy when hot water demand is low.
Professional Installation and Service:
Have your RUS65eP installed and serviced by a qualified technician who specializes in tankless water heaters. They can ensure that the unit is set up correctly and offer advice on optimizing performance.
By following these steps, you can optimize the performance of your Rinnai RUS65eP tankless water heater to meet your household's hot water needs efficiently while saving energy and ensuring long-term reliability. Regular maintenance and thoughtful adjustments to your hot water usage patterns can contribute to a comfortable and cost-effective hot water solution for your home.
